How does acupuncture and moxibustion help people lose weight

Acupuncture and moxibustion weight loss is mainly achieved by regulating human endocrine and neural function, inhibiting appetite, promoting metabolism and other mechanisms, specifically involving acupoint stimulation, gastrointestinal function regulation and other physiological functions.

One of the core mechanisms of acupuncture and moxibustion for weight loss is to regulate the function of hypothalamus pituitary target gland axis. Acupuncture at specific acupoints such as Zusanli and Zhongwan affects the hypothalamic feeding center through neurohumoral conduction, reducing the secretion of ghrelin and increasing leptin sensitivity, thereby reducing the desire to eat. Some obese people have hypothyroidism. acupuncture and moxibustion can improve the thyroid hormone level and increase the basic metabolic rate by about 5% -15%. This metabolic regulatory effect can cause the human body to burn more calories in a resting state. Electroacupuncture is commonly used in clinical practice to stimulate abdominal acupoints such as the Tian Shu and Da Heng, which can cause rhythmic contractions of local muscles, similar to passive exercise effects.

Gastrointestinal function regulation is another important pathway. Acupuncture can improve vagus nerve excitability, delay gastric emptying time, and enhance satiety. Experiments have shown that stimulation of acupoints such as Sanyinjiao can reduce the frequency of gastric electrical activity and prolong the residence time of food in the stomach. At the same time, acupuncture and moxibustion can correct the intestinal flora disorder, reduce the absorption of inflammatory substances such as lipopolysaccharide, and reduce the probability of visceral fat deposition. For obese individuals with insulin resistance, acupuncture at acupoints such as Yishu can help improve glucose and lipid metabolism. Different acupuncture and moxibustion schools will combine auricular point sticking and pressing, acupoint catgut embedding and other methods to enhance the effect through continuous stimulation. During treatment, it is recommended to follow a low glycemic index diet and avoid eating at night to maintain insulin sensitivity.

acupuncture and moxibustion weight loss should be carried out under the operation of professional Chinese medicine doctors, usually 10-15 times as a course of treatment, and the best effect is that the interval between two treatments does not exceed 3 days. Transient thirst and fatigue may occur after treatment, which is a normal reaction and requires timely hydration and electrolyte supplementation. It is forbidden to apply needles to pregnant women, bleeding constitution and skin infection sites. diabetes patients need to inform doctors in advance to adjust insulin dosage. During the treatment, keep regular work and rest, avoid staying up late to affect the leptin secretion cycle. It is recommended to carry out aerobic exercise 3-5 times a week to consolidate the effect of acupuncture and moxibustion. Note that weight loss by acupuncture and moxibustion is not just water loss. Ketone bodies will be produced during fat decomposition. Proper supplementation of B vitamins will help to eliminate metabolic wastes.
